The Honda Elevate is offered in four trims — SV, V, VX, and ZX. There's also a ZX Black Edition for those who want something a bit different. Prices start at Rs 11.91 lakh for the entry-level SV trim, and go up to Rs 16.63 lakh for the fully loaded ZX. The ZX Black Edition sits at the top, priced between Rs 15.51 lakh and Rs 16.73 lakh, depending on the configuration.
The Honda Elevate comes with a 1.5-litre, four-cylinder naturally-aspirated petrol engine. You can choose between a 6-speed manual or a smooth CVT gearbox. The CVT version is rated to deliver around 16.92 km/l, while the manual offers about 15.31 km/l.
